Essex: Epping Forest (now in the London Boroughs of Waltham Forest and Redbridge). Plans of the (1) northern and (2) southern parts of the forest, showing waste lands. Scales: (1) 1 inch to 12 chains; (2) 1 inch to 13 chains. Surveyed by Messrs Driver. Dimensions of sheets: (1) 94 cm x 177.5 cm; (2) 99 cm x 124.5 cm.
